Transaction 84dbe78f311b0dfc04bc138ecee7995af4e33da914bb11f4d4583408b75c04dc
1 Input
1 Output
-
84dbe78f311b0dfc04bc138ecee7995af4e33da914bb11f4d4583408b75c04dc:0
- value
- 15172228
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f9aa1928d81ca97eeccc93ceee21a7494efc2b15 OP_EQUAL
- address
- 3QT7wwmqtFtEUfGhWB3BSpsauLziwAi5ow